How to Turn Off iPhone 14
Turning off your iPhone 14 is straightforward and only takes a few seconds. Let’s walk through the process to make sure you’re doing it correctly.
Step 1: Press and Hold Buttons
To start, press and hold the side button and either volume button at the same time.
Holding these buttons will prompt your phone to display the power-off slider. It’s like finding the secret handshake that your phone recognizes to begin the shutdown process.
Step 2: Slide to Power Off
Next, slide the on-screen slider to the right to turn off your iPhone.
Once you see the slider, it’s time for action. Moving it to the right will let your phone know you mean business, and it’ll start shutting down.
Step 3: Wait for Shutdown
Now, wait for your iPhone to completely turn off.
It might take a moment, but you’ll soon see your screen go dark. This means your iPhone is taking a nap until you’re ready to wake it up again.
After completing these steps, your iPhone 14 will be powered off. This can help save battery or solve minor issues. When you’re ready to use it again, just press and hold the side button until the Apple logo appears.
Tips for Turning Off iPhone 14
- If your iPhone doesn’t respond, try a force restart by quickly pressing and releasing the volume up, then volume down, and finally holding the side button.
- For regular power-offs, make sure you don’t hold the side button alone, or you’ll activate Siri instead.
- If your screen is unresponsive, turning off your phone can sometimes fix the issue.
- Regularly restarting your iPhone can help improve its performance and resolve minor glitches.
- Keeping your software updated might prevent the need for frequent restarts.
Frequently Asked Questions
Why won’t my iPhone 14 turn off?
If your phone isn’t turning off, ensure you’re pressing both the side and volume buttons simultaneously. If it’s still not working, try a force restart.
Can I turn off my iPhone 14 without using buttons?
Yes, go to Settings > General > Shut Down to turn off your device without using buttons.
What should I do if my iPhone freezes while turning off?
Try a force restart. Quickly press and release the volume up button, then the volume down button, and hold the side button until the Apple logo appears.
Will turning off my iPhone delete any data?
No, turning off your iPhone simply powers it down. Your data and apps remain intact.
How often should I turn off my iPhone 14?
It’s a good idea to turn it off occasionally, perhaps once a week, to help maintain performance.
